Description Alan Richter 2019-03-10 17:41:13 CET
Description of problem:
After kernel 5.0.0-1 X fails to start, this message also appears in dmesg:

[drm:amdgpu_init [amdgpu]] *ERROR* VGACON disables amdgpu kernel modesetting.

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
kernel 5.0.0-3 and later

How reproducible:
Always.

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Boot. 
2. telinit 5.
3.

This issue has not appeared on a cauldron system with nVidia nor on the i915 driver.  

My video card is a Ryzen 5 2400g with Vega graphics.  

Everything works fine on 5.0.0-1.
Comment 1 Alan Richter 2019-03-10 17:42:34 CET
One more thing, this is my kernel boot line:

nokmsboot splash quiet noiswmd resume=UUID=c5b92902-d3ff-40fc-9c9b-327be6d5c625 audit=0
Comment 2 Thomas Backlund 2019-03-10 22:00:26 CET
Remove "nokmsboot" from the kernel command line.

It's only needed for nVidia proprietary drivers

CC: (none) => tmb

Comment 3 Alan Richter 2019-03-10 22:28:26 CET
That did it, thank you, please close this issue.
